The start of the year is often a time for making resolutions Do you know what a resolution is ? It’s a kind of promise. Most of the time, we make promises to other people. (“Mom, I promise I’m going to tidy my room when I get back from school.” ) However, promises you make to yourself are resolutions, and the most common kind is New Year’s resolutions. _____________________ When we make resolutions at the beginning of the year, we hope that we are going to improve our lives. Some people write down their resolutions and plans for the coming year. This helps them to remember their resolutions. Others tell their family and friends about their wishes and plans.D
There are different kinds of resolutions. Some are about physical health. For example, some people promise themselves they are going to start an exercise program or eat less fast food.Many resolutions have to do with self-improvement. ___________Some people might say they are going to take up a hobby like painting or taking photos, or learn to play the guitar. Some resolutions have to do with better planning, like making a weekly plan for schoolwork. ____________

Although there are differences, most resolutions have one thing in common.People hardly ever keep them ! ________Sometimes the resolutions may be too difficult to keep. Sometimes people just forget about them. For this reason, some people say the best resolution is to have no resolutions! How about you --- Will you make any next year?
